Keyboard class

Constructors

Keyboard(AsyncRequestClient _client, WebDriverHandler _handler)

Properties

hashCode int
The hash code for this object. [...]
read-only, override
runtimeType Type
A representation of the runtime type of the object.
read-only, inherited

Methods

sendChord(Iterable<String> chordToSend) Future<void>
Simulate pressing many keys at once as a 'chord'.
sendKeys(String keysToSend) Future<void>
Send keysToSend to the active element.
toString() String
Returns a string representation of this object.
override
noSuchMethod(Invocation invocation) → dynamic
Invoked when a non-existent method or property is accessed. [...]
inherited

Operators

operator ==(dynamic other) bool
The equality operator. [...]
override

Constants

add → const String
'\uE025'
alt → const String
'\uE00A'
backSpace → const String
'\uE003'
cancel → const String
'\uE001'
clear → const String
'\uE005'
command → const String
'\uE03D'
control → const String
'\uE009'
decimal → const String
'\uE028'
delete → const String
'\uE017'
divide → const String
'\uE029'
down → const String
'\uE015'
end → const String
'\uE010'
enter → const String
'\uE007'
equals → const String
'\uE019'
escape → const String
'\uE00C'
f1 → const String
'\uE031'
f2 → const String
'\uE032'
f3 → const String
'\uE033'
f4 → const String
'\uE034'
f5 → const String
'\uE035'
f6 → const String
'\uE036'
f7 → const String
'\uE037'
f8 → const String
'\uE038'
f9 → const String
'\uE039'
f10 → const String
'\uE03A'
f11 → const String
'\uE03B'
f12 → const String
'\uE03C'
help → const String
'\uE002'
home → const String
'\uE011'
insert → const String
'\uE016'
left → const String
'\uE012'
meta → const String
command
multiply → const String
'\uE024'
nullChar → const String
'\uE000'
numpad0 → const String
'\uE01A'
numpad1 → const String
'\uE01B'
numpad2 → const String
'\uE01C'
numpad3 → const String
'\uE01D'
numpad4 → const String
'\uE01E'
numpad5 → const String
'\uE01F'
numpad6 → const String
'\uE020'
numpad7 → const String
'\uE021'
numpad8 → const String
'\uE022'
numpad9 → const String
'\uE023'
pageDown → const String
'\uE00F'
pageUp → const String
'\uE00E'
pause → const String
'\uE00B'
returnChar → const String
'\uE006'
'\uE014'
semicolon → const String
'\uE018'
separator → const String
'\uE026'
shift → const String
'\uE008'
space → const String
'\uE00D'
subtract → const String
'\uE027'
tab → const String
'\uE004'
up → const String
'\uE013'